A romantic surprise

The week had gone by in a flash. The last day of Jenny's visit had already come and everyone fell in love with her. Including Jason. With each passing day, each silly joke and every minute they spent together, Jason caught himself falling in love more and more. Bringing Jenny into his life was the first good thing his mother had done for him in a long time. She was right, this girl was perfect for him. He was certain she was the one. So yesterday he caught himself thinking, why wait any longer? He started thinking about how and when he would propose to Jenny. For him it could not be any sooner, but he knew this was a romantic surprise he could not mess up. Therefore careful planning was essential. he wanted to propose with something he had picked out based on her preferences and with her in mind. Though he had gotten to know a lot about Jenny in these past few days, it was impossible to know all details and a engagement ring was something that unfortunately fell under the category details. So he was trying to figure out what kind of ring she would like based on what he did know about her. The more he thought about it, the more frustrated he got. I mean, he knew she wasn't materialistic, but every girl wanted a grand proposal with a beautiful ring right?

Should he buy her a new ring, or should he use the family heirloom. The heirloom had been in the family for at least three generations. It was a princess cut diamond ring in a platinum gold band. It had belonged to his great grandmother and till now everyone who had used that ring to propose had been successful. He liked those odds very much. But on the other hand, she might want something unique and not something that had been used for many proposals before hers. He knew his problem could be solved by asking her mother for advise, but he did not want anyone knowing about the proposal before the actual person involved. After racking his brain all through the night, he finally thought of a perfect plan. His birthday was in a month from now, so instead of Jenny giving him a birthday present, he would ask her to be his wife. He could even hide the ring in the cake topper. He would pretend that it fell and broke and as he would pick it up, he would be on one knee and he would ask her to marry him. That way she could start moving to England in her spring break. It was flawless. How could she deny his birthday wish, he snickered as he was lost in thought.

- back to the present -

Jason and Jenny were in her room and as she was packing, they were planning their next visit. They agreed that this time Jason would be visiting them in the Netherlands. This way Jenny could show him around the town she grew up in and he could even meet her friends. In between they would talk on the phone or send each other messages. Jenny's flight wasn't until late that night, so after packing they decided to go on a walk by the lake. Jenny had fallen in love with that lake. It was so peaceful. It was so beautiful. One would not believe that it was in someone's front yard. As sat down on the freshly mowed grass, they were deep in conversation. Jenny was in the middle of telling Jason a funny story about her and her friends during one of their classes. She was talking about the silly teacher of arts and crafts who had physically blocked the exit of the classroom, because of a piece of fabric that was lying on the floor and she was determined to find the "culprit". Even after one of her friends had offered to pick up the fabric and put it back in it's place, the teacher was adamant that no one was to leave as long as the one who had "committed the crime" did not confess him- or herself!. As Jenny was telling this story, she made sure she was enacting the voices of the important characters. This had always been Jenny's specialty. This and witty come backs. Soon both could not hold in their laughs and they were rolling on the grass. While Jenny tried to continue her story in between laughs and gasps for air, Jason could not help but stare at this silly girl. Her eyes had turned to half their size, her face had lit up and she was showing the small dimples in her cheeks. Before he knew it, he subconsciously got on one knee and took out the ring he had been carrying since yesterday. He opened the box gently and asked, "Dear Jenny I know we haven't know each other for very long, but I can already tell that you are the one for me. If you feel the same way, I would like to ask you to make me the happiest man alive and marry me."
